Ethanol Fireplaces

Ethanol fireplaces don't require chimneys, flues, or gas lines, which makes them easy to install in apartments and condos. Fireplaces that are vent-free can be found in tabletop, wall mounted or freestanding models.

They also require minimal maintenance and don't produce any smoke or the ash. Find out more about the advantages and disadvantages of ethanol fireplaces.

3. Easy to Maintain

Ethanol Fireplaces are less difficult to maintain than traditional fire places. They don't create soot or ash, and they can be used outdoors or indoors. They do not require a chimney, making them a good option for apartments. They're typically a simple installation project that can be accomplished by anyone who knows how to use drills.

The most important thing you need to do is ensure that your ethanol fire stays full of fuel and clean it up regularly. Keep any flammable material away from the fireplace. Make sure you only use the amount of fuel the manufacturer suggests. If you use too much fuel, it can cause the flame to become too large and could set combustible objects on fire. It's also important to place the fireplace in a place where it isn't able to be hit or struck by objects that move around it when it's in use.

Most ethanol fireplaces do not produce a lot of heat, so they should not be used as a primary source of heat. Some models have a heat setting that can be adjustable. The higher the setting, the more heat it produces.

When selecting an ethanol fire one, you should look for one that's certified by a reliable organization. This is a sign that the manufacturer is committed to security. Also, look out for features that can help keep your fireplace safe, like an enclosure that regulates the size of the flame, and a spill tray.
